- Abstract
Emotions play a vital role in human existence as they reflect an individual’s internal state. Currently, emotion recognition is extensively employed to obtain automated feedback from individuals. Among the various methods available, facial expression recognition is considered the most effective means of capturing human emotions. Computational models of emotions are automated systems designed to accomplish the task of recognizing emotions and deriving meaningful insights from them. This paper compares the various algorithms used for emotion recognition and presents a framework that can serve as a foundation for developing a computational model of emotions, providing a concise overview of all its components.
